Caring for Your Luxury Leather Belt
Preserving the Quality of Your Belts
Maintaining the elegance and charm of your brown leather belt goes beyond its initial purchase. It involves a commitment to care and attention that ensures your investment stays pristine.- Regular Maintenance: Regularly clean your leather belts with a dry, soft cloth to remove dust and debris. For deeper cleaning, opt for a leather cleaner specifically designed for genuine leather, avoiding any harsh chemicals that might damage the finish.
- Conditioning: Just like our own skin, leather can lose its essential oils over time, leading to cracks and wear. Apply a quality leather conditioner every few months. This act rejuvenates the material, maintaining its supple texture and rich color.
- Storage: Store your belts away from direct sunlight and moisture, which can deteriorate the leather quality. A cool, dry place is ideal. Consider using a belt hanger to maintain its shape and prevent unnecessary creasing.
- Caring for the Buckle: The buckle is a critical component that can become scratched or tarnished. Use a gentle metal cleaner for buckles made of materials like stainless steel, and ensure it's completely dry before fastening again.
Styling Tips for Brown Leather Belts
Mastering the Art of Wearing Brown Leather Belts
Brown leather belts are a versatile accessory that can seamlessly elevate any outfit, whether you're dressing up for a formal occasion or keeping it casual. Here are some styling tips to help you make the most of your brown leather belt:
- Match with Your Shoes: One of the golden rules of wearing a brown leather belt is to match it with your shoes. A dark brown belt pairs well with similar-toned shoes, creating a cohesive look that exudes sophistication.
- Consider the Occasion: For formal events, opt for a sleek leather dress belt. It should be thin, with a classic buckle, and complement your suit. For more casual settings, a full grain leather belt with a more robust buckle can add a touch of rugged charm.
- Size Matters: Ensure your belt is the correct size. A belt that's too long or too short can disrupt the balance of your outfit. Typically, a belt should fit comfortably in the middle hole, providing both style and comfort.
- Experiment with Textures: Don't shy away from exploring different textures. A grain leather belt can add an interesting dimension to your ensemble, while a reversible belt offers versatility for varied looks.
- Seasonal Considerations: During the warmer months, lighter shades of brown can complement your summer wardrobe. In contrast, a dark brown belt is ideal for the colder months, pairing well with deeper hues and heavier fabrics.

The Environmental Impact of Leather Goods
Understanding the Environmental Impact
When it comes to luxury leather goods, including the classic brown leather belt, it's essential to consider the environmental impact of leather production. Leather, especially full grain leather, is renowned for its durability and timeless appeal. However, the process of creating these exquisite pieces can have significant environmental consequences.
The tanning process, which gives leather its desired qualities, often involves chemicals that can be harmful to the environment if not managed properly. While genuine leather belts are celebrated for their quality, the industry is gradually shifting towards more sustainable practices. Many brands are now exploring eco-friendly tanning methods and sourcing leather from suppliers committed to reducing their carbon footprint.
Moreover, the rise of faux leather and other alternatives is gaining traction among environmentally conscious consumers. These materials offer a cruelty-free option, but often lack the durability and classic appeal of genuine leather.
